Mahatma Gandhi
A shy lawyer who couldn't speak in court; a train ejection in South Africa set the course.
Mahatma Gandhi was born in 1869 in Porbandar, Gujarat, British India. Mahatma Gandhi's background is described as Gujarati Hindu; merchant-caste family. Growing up, the family was affluent — his father served as diwan (chief minister) of the Porbandar princely state; a prosperous, devout household. The pathway
- 1891 · age 21A failed law practice
Back from London, he is too shy to speak in his first Bombay court case and returns the client's fee.
- 1893 · age 23Pietermaritzburg
Takes a one-year clerk's contract in South Africa; is ejected from a first-class carriage for his skin color and stays 21 years to fight such laws.
- 1906 · age 36Satyagraha
Launches nonviolent resistance against pass laws in the Transvaal.
- 1915 · age 45Returns to India
Tours the country third-class before entering politics.
- 1930 · age 60The Salt March
390 km on foot to make salt in defiance of the British monopoly; some 60,000 arrests follow.
- 1947 · age 77Independence — and partition
Spends independence day fasting in Calcutta against communal violence rather than celebrating in Delhi.
- 1948 · age 78Assassinated
Shot by a Hindu nationalist at a prayer meeting.
